Na Lei Aloha Hula Dinner
Show
Experience Na Lei Aloha, a brand new evening show that takes
place in the heart of Waikiki at the outdoor terrace of the Hyatt
Regency Waikiki Beach Resort & Spa. This show is an immersive
cultural experience about the art of the Hawaiian lei, with stories
shared through authentic island music and hula dance.

Buffet
Dinner Menu:
The Standard and VIP dinner show packages both include a
delicious
international buffet dinner by The Buffet at Hyatt. Experience a fusion
of traditional Hawaiian flavors and modern Korean-inspired cuisine,
featuring locally-sourced ingredients and expert culinary craftsmanship.
A choice of tropical beverage, beer, wine and non-alcoholic drink is
included. Show Only packages are available as well that do not include
dinner.
